Note that as long as the `setq` is within the magicalcustom-autogenerated-user-settings form, it will behave correctly even
if the variable has a setter function. The difference will only affect
those users who take this code and then copy it elsewhere.But setq doesn't have any concrete benefit other than familiarity to people who don't understand custom. I've spent more time than I wish on Freenode #emacs teaching people about custom.
